查看IP端口的指令在不同的操作系统中有所不同。以下是一些常见操作系统的查看方法:
在Windows系统中,可以使用以下命令查看IP端口:
netstat
命令netstat -ano
-a
显示所有连接和监听端口。-n
以数字形式显示地址和端口号。-o
显示与每个连接关联的进程ID。Get-NetTCPConnection
PowerShell 命令Get-NetTCPConnection
这个命令会列出所有当前的TCP连接及其状态。
在Linux系统中,可以使用以下命令查看IP端口:
netstat
命令netstat -tuln
-t
显示TCP连接。-u
显示UDP连接。-l
仅显示监听套接字。-n
以数字形式显示地址和端口号。ss
命令ss -tuln
ss
命令是 netstat
的替代品,通常更快且提供更多信息。
lsof
命令sudo lsof -i -P -n | grep LISTEN
-i
选择网络文件。-P
禁止端口号转换。-n
禁止IP地址转换。grep LISTEN
过滤出监听状态的端口。在macOS系统中,可以使用以下命令查看IP端口:
netstat
命令netstat -anv
-a
显示所有连接和监听端口。-n
以数字形式显示地址和端口号。-v
显示详细信息。lsof
命令sudo lsof -i -P -n | grep LISTEN
与Linux类似,用于列出监听状态的端口。
sudo
提升权限,在Windows上以管理员身份运行命令提示符。netstat
或 ss
),可以通过包管理器进行安装。例如,在Debian/Ubuntu系统上:netstat
或 ss
),可以通过包管理器进行安装。例如,在Debian/Ubuntu系统上:grep
进行过滤,例如查找特定端口号:grep
进行过滤,例如查找特定端口号:通过以上方法,你可以有效地查看和管理系统中的IP端口。
领取专属 10元无门槛券
手把手带您无忧上云